negligee

word

Definition

A negligee is a woman's thin, loose, and often sheer nightdress, usually worn as sleepwear or lingerie.

Usage & Nuances

Negligee is mostly used in fashion, lingerie, or intimate contexts. It has a romantic or sensual connotation and is not a general term for all nightwear. Pronounced ‘NEG-li-zhay’. Avoid confusing it with 'nightgown' (which is less revealing). Typically singular.
